WCPL 2026 Final: Trinbago Knight Riders Face Guyana Amazon Warriors Today

Advertisement

Today, the Trinbago Knight Riders will take on the Guyana Amazon Warriors in the final of the inaugural Women’s Caribbean Premier League (WCPL) at the Kensington Oval in Bridgetown, Barbados. This highly anticipated match is set to begin at 2 PM local time (11:30 PM IST, 7 PM UK time) and promises to be a thrilling conclusion to the tournament.

The Knight Riders secured their place in the final by finishing at the top of the points table, boasting two victories and just one loss across three matches. Their consistent performance throughout the tournament has established them as formidable contenders. In contrast, the Warriors earned their spot in the final by defeating the defending champions, the Barbados Tridents, in a tense Eliminator match held on September 16. The match was shortened to eight overs per side due to rain, with the Tridents managing to score 69 runs, thanks in part to Maddy Green's unbeaten 30 runs off 16 balls.

Despite the Tridents' efforts, the Warriors successfully chased down the target with four balls remaining, showcasing their batting prowess. Tazmin Brits emerged as a standout performer for the Warriors, finishing the match not out with 35 runs off 23 balls, which included three fours and two sixes. This victory not only propelled the Warriors into the final but also highlighted their capability to perform under pressure.

As the Knight Riders prepare to face the Warriors, the matchup will see two of the tournament's top teams led by two exceptional captains: Deandra Dottin for the Knight Riders and Chloe Tryon for the Warriors. Both players have been instrumental in their teams' journeys to the final, and their leadership will be crucial in determining the outcome of this decisive match.

Fans across the Caribbean can catch the action live on RUSH Sports, with specific regional broadcasters including CCN TV in Grenada, E-Networks in Guyana, WinnersTV in St Lucia, and TV6 in Trinidad & Tobago. In India, the match will be available on the Star Sports Network, while viewers in the United Kingdom can watch it on TNT Sports. Australian fans can tune in via Fox Sports, and those in New Zealand can catch the game on Sky Sports NZ. In North America, Willow TV will broadcast the final, and for viewers in the MENA region, the match will be streamed on Cricbuzz. SuperSport will cover the event in Sub-Saharan Africa, and fans worldwide can watch it via the WCPL YouTube channel and Facebook page.
